Thermal Balance Comparison and Selection Recommendations for Compact Excavators

Mar. 30, 2026

Share:

I. International Brands (Benchmarks for Thermal Balance)

1. Komatsu

· Core strengths: Full-working-condition thermal balance + intelligent temperature control + high reliability

· Adopts the Modine EVantage liquid cooling system with multi-loop independent temperature control, enabling precise zoned heat dissipation for batteries, electric drives and hydraulic systems.

· The engine is deeply matched with the hydraulic system, with an oil temperature control accuracy of ±2℃, ensuring unattenuated continuous operation in high-temperature environments.

· Electronically controlled fan + intelligent thermal management algorithm enable stable operation in a wide temperature range of -10℃~45℃.

· Representative models: PC35MR-5, PC55MR-5 (benchmarks for thermal balance of small excavators).

2. Liebherr

· Core strengths: Self-developed full-link thermal management + ultimate structural heat dissipation

· Self-developed engine, hydraulic and electronic control systems, optimized power cabin flow field, and 30% improvement in heat dissipation efficiency.

· Independent hydraulic oil cooling circuit + plate heat exchanger, maintaining oil temperature stably at 35–55℃.

· Verified thermal balance under three working conditions (plateau, high temperature, frigid zone), supporting 12 hours of full-load continuous operation without overheating.

· Representative models: R914 Compact, A 918 Compact (benchmarks for thermal balance of wheeled small excavators).

3. Kubota

· Core strengths: Engine inherent thermal balance + compact and efficient heat dissipation

· Direct injection engine + ultra-low emission combustion technology, featuring low thermal load and reduced heat dissipation pressure.

· Integrated oil-water cooling + high-flow radiator, with a compact structure, fast heat dissipation and low failure rate.

· Intelligent idle speed + ECO mode reduce invalid heat generation and ensure strong stability in continuous operation.

· Representative models: KX057-4, U55-5 (renowned for excellent thermal balance among small excavators).


II. Domestic Brands (First Tier of Thermal Balance)

1. Sunward Intelligent

· Core strengths: Precise temperature control + high-load continuous operation

· Fin-type radiator + variable oil cooling system, with an oil temperature control accuracy of ±3℃.

· In-depth matching and calibration of the engine-hydraulic-heat dissipation system, achieving optimal thermal balance in the low-speed high-efficiency zone.

· Models such as SWE80E9 support 12 hours of high-intensity continuous operation without overheating.

2. Sany Heavy Industry

· Core strengths: Integrated thermal management + intelligent temperature control

· Thermal management for both fuel and electric platforms: high-flow heat dissipation + electronically controlled fan for fuel engines; multi-loop liquid cooling + AI thermal balance algorithm for electric models.

· Collaborative control of the engine, hydraulic and heat dissipation systems ensures stable full-load oil temperature and unattenuated power.

· Verified thermal balance reliability under the harsh working conditions of high altitude, high temperature, high dust and heavy load.

3. Yuchai Equipment (formerly Yuchai Heavy Industry)

· Core strengths: Compact and high efficiency + integrated oil-water cooling

· Integrated oil-water cooling system is adopted for small excavators, with the water tank and oil cooler sharing a single fan, featuring a compact structure and high heat dissipation efficiency.

· Equipped with Kubota engine + load-sensing hydraulic system, realizing low thermal load and stable continuous operation.

· Exported to more than 100 countries worldwide, with excellent thermal balance performance under high-temperature, frigid and high-dust working conditions.

III. Thermal Balance Capability Comparison (Compact Excavators)

BrandCore TechnologyTemperature Control AccuracyContinuous Operation CapabilityApplicable Working Conditions
KomatsuModine liquid cooling + intelligent algorithm±2℃Extremely strong (24h+)All working conditions/extreme high temperature
LiebherrSelf-developed full-link + flow field optimization±2℃Extremely strong (12h+)Heavy load/plateau
KubotaInherent low heat generation + compact heat dissipation±3℃Strong (10h+)Municipal/garden/routine
Sunward IntelligentVariable oil cooling + precise matching±3℃Strong (12h+)High intensity/municipal
SanyIntegrated thermal management + AI temperature control±3℃Strong (10h+)Multi-working condition/electrification
YuchaiIntegrated oil-water cooling + compact layout±3℃Strong (8–10h)Export/multi-scenario

IV. Selection Recommendations

· For pursuit of ultimate thermal balance/extreme working conditions: Choose Komatsu or Liebherr (sufficient budget required).

· For routine working conditions + high cost performance: Choose Kubota, Sunward Intelligent or Sany.

· For domestic market + export + compact layout requirements: Choose Yuchai (featuring integrated oil-water heat dissipation, compact structure and easy maintenance).
